    The worse thing you can do is wash raw meat :eek:

    Some consumers think that by washing they are removing bacteria from the meat and making it safe. Although washing these raw food items may get rid of some of the bacteria, it also allows the bacteria to spread around the kitchen. For safety, use a food thermometer to be sure the food has reached a safe minimum internal temperature. Beef, veal, and lamb steaks, roasts, and chops can be cooked to 145 °F. All cuts of pork should reach 160 °F. All poultry should reach a safe minimum internal temperature of 165 °F.
